Example cocktail server requirements on a job description

Cocktail server requirements can be divided into technical requirements and required soft skills. The lists below show the most common requirements included in cocktail server job postings.
Sample cocktail server requirements
  • At least 21 years of age.
  • Alcohol Awareness Certification.
  • Ability to lift and carry up to 30 lbs.
  • Knowledge of safe alcohol consumption.
  • Ability to count money accurately and make change.
Sample required cocktail server soft skills
  • Excellent customer service skills.
  • Outgoing and friendly personality.
  • Ability to multitask and prioritize.
  • Knowledge of food and beverage menus.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ment.

Cocktail Server job description example 3

The Marcus Corporation cocktail server job description

Service of beverage and food in a friendly, courteous, and timely manner resulting in guest satisfaction.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
1. Checks and maintains proper set-up and cleanliness of service station before, during, and after shift.
2. Greets guests in a timely, friendly, and courteous manner and explains all specials, promotions, and snacks.
3. Takes orders, reciting selection of all call and premium brands as requested, requires memorization of all available drinks, beer, and taps.
4. Provides appropriate snack and garnish with all beverages.
5. Inputs orders into point of sale system to inform bartender an order was made in a timely manner.
6. Maintains cleanliness of guest tables and assists with the bar area.
7. Replenishes beverages as requested, frequently checking back with guest to inquire about satisfaction.
8. Presents the guest with the check promptly, thanking them and inviting them to return, so they will frequent the restaurant again.
9. Performs general cleaning tasks, using standard cleaning products as assigned by your supervisor to adhere to health standards.
10. Performs other duties and responsibilities as requested e.g., special guest requests.

POSITION REQUIREMENTS:
1. Must have basic knowledge of food and beverage preparation and service of various alcoholic beverages.
2. Knowledge of the appropriate table settings, service ware, and menu items.
3. Ability to read, sufficient to understand menus and special promotions, speak and write the English language to communicate with the guest, and take orders.
4. Ability to remember, recite, and promote a variety of menu items.
5. Ability to transport trays weighing up to 40 lbs. through a crowded room on a continuous basis throughout shift.
6. Must adhere to all State, Federal, and Corporate liquor regulations pertaining to serving alcoholic beverages to minors and intoxicated guests to ensure all laws are being followed.
7. Maintain a positive attitude throughout shift.
8. Perform all assigned side work and complete daily checklist.
9. Work as a team player.
10. Ability to remain motivated during busy and slow periods within shift.
11. Cash handling and self-banking position, requires ability to maintain funds, and accurately count back charge.
12. Ability to operate a keyboard and learn point of sale procedures to pre-check an order and close out a check
13. No prior experience required. Prior cocktail experience preferred.
14. Ability to obtain any government required license or certificate. TIPS certification required. Bartender certification preferred.
